Dnaagdawenmag Binnoojiiyag Child & Family Services is a multi-service Indigenous Child Well-Being Agency. We provide a stable foundation for children, youth, and families through wraparound services that are culturally based and family focused. We seek to support our families with care and authenticity, recognizing and respecting spirit. We form a holistic, inclusive, and nonjudgmental circle of care with our children at the center.
Reporting to the Support Services Supervisor - Clinical Services, the Child & Youth Mental Health and Addictions Worker (CYMHAW) plays a vital role in delivering holistic supportive counselling and services to children, youth, and their families experiencing mental health and addictions challenges. This includes referrals for confidential individual, family, or group counselling, and support for navigating mental health and addiction services. The position also supports the Clinical Services team in delivering clinical support under the guidance of clinical staff.
